![]() More pixels and larger pixels mean the sensor can take in more light, allowing it to get a more accurate reading of the scene and lowering the chance of digital noise. With a sensor that is over 2.5 times the surface area of a standard APS-C sensor, full-frame cameras are capable of having larger pixels and, in some cases, more pixels than APS-C cameras. When it comes to overall image quality, full-frame cameras have a definite advantage over APS-C cameras. Image Quality Differences Between APS-C and Full-Frame Full-frame sensors help reduce the risk of noise even in these extreme scenarios. These larger pixels are especially helpful when shooting in higher ISO settings, as higher ISO lends itself to noisier, grainy images. The larger pixels are able to take in more light, which reduces image noise. ![]() This larger sensor allows for larger individual pixels, which permits better image quality. Full-frame sensors tend to have more than 2.5 times the surface area of a standard APS-C sensor. However, with 35mm film, APS-C has a significant crop factor (more on that later).Īs the name implies, for full-frame cameras the sensor fills the entire frame of traditional 35mm film. This film was only 24mm wide, so most APS-C sensors did not lose a significant amount of information when using this film. In comparison, one of the more popular sizes of APS-C sensors only measures 22mm by 15mm.ĪPS-C sensors, also called crop sensors, are named from the antiquated APS film that was popular in the 1990s but is now discontinued. According to Techradar, a full-frame camera is one that uses a sensor that is identical in size to a single frame of 35mm film.
